Figure out the Purpose:
Decide how you wish to use your porch Construction. Will it be a place to unwind, captivate, or as a port for plants?
Set a Budget:
Estimate the total expense, consisting of products, labor, and permits. It's necessary to have a clear budget to prevent overspending.
Choose a Style:
Consider architectural styles that match your home. Research study various designs and products.
Inspect Local Regulations:
Verify regional building regulations and zoning policies. Some locations require licenses for Porch Improvement building and construction.
Develop a Design:

Do I require a license to build a porch?
Yes, in a lot of locations, you will need a permit. Contact your regional structure department for requirements specific to your location.
2. How long does it take to develop a porch?
The time frame can vary based on the size and complexity of the design. A simple porch might take a few days, while bigger structures could take weeks.
3. What is the typical cost of building a porch?
The cost can range extensively based upon size, materials, and area. Usually, house owners may invest between ₤ 5,000 to ₤ 15,000 for a brand-new porch.
